What does Lakshmish mean?
Derived from Lakshmi, the Hindu goddess of wealth, prosperity, and fortune, and 'ish', meaning 'lord'.

Spiritual & cultural context
Represents abundance and good fortune.
The name "Lakshmish" holds deep cultural significance within the Hindu community. It is believed that the divine goddess Lakshmi grants material wealth and spiritual prosperity to those who seek her blessings. By having 'Lakshmi' as a part of their name, individuals hope to attract her divine grace, leading to an abundant and prosperous life.
